Index: cc/resources/tile_task_worker_pool_perftest.cc |
diff --git a/cc/resources/tile_task_worker_pool_perftest.cc b/cc/resources/tile_task_worker_pool_perftest.cc |
index b36dd1223cc67fefb9f7f5292c96b08c4c493595..27b0154697edcffe614c4fe8894a7690a18fc79b 100644 |
--- a/cc/resources/tile_task_worker_pool_perftest.cc |
+++ b/cc/resources/tile_task_worker_pool_perftest.cc |
@@ -90,6 +90,10 @@ class PerfContextProvider : public ContextProvider { |
reinterpret_cast<GrBackendContext>(null_interface.get()))); |
return gr_context_.get(); |
} |
+ void InvalidateGrContext(uint32_t state) override { |
+ if (gr_context_) |
+ gr_context_.get()->resetContext(state); |
+ } |
void SetupLock() override {} |
base::Lock* GetLock() override { return &context_lock_; } |
bool IsContextLost() override { return false; } |